2. Eligibility Requirements for Obtaining a Turkish Visa
To obtain a TURKEY VISA FROM FIJI, there are certain eligibility requirements that must be met. Firstly, applicants must have a valid passport with at least six months of validity left from the date of entry into Turkey. They must also have a return ticket or onward travel arrangements, as well as sufficient funds to cover their stay in Turkey. It’s important to note that meeting these requirements does not guarantee the issuance of a visa. 3. Understanding the Types of Visas Available for Travelers from Dominican Republic and Fiji
When planning a trip to Turkey from the Dominican Republic or Fiji, it is important to understand the types of visas available for travelers. There are several options to choose from, including the e-Visa, sticker visa, and diplomatic visa. The e-Visa is the most common and convenient option, as it can be obtained online and allows for stays of up to 90 days. The sticker visa is issued by Turkish embassies or consulates and is suitable for longer stays or multiple entries. Diplomatic visas are reserved for government officials and their families. It is crucial to carefully consider which visa type is appropriate for your travel plans and to ensure that you meet all eligibility requirements before applying. 5. What Documents are Required When Applying For A Turkish Visa?
When applying for a Turkish visa from Dominican Republic or Fiji, there are several documents that are required to complete the application process. Firstly, applicants must provide a valid passport with at least six months remaining before its expiration date. Additionally, applicants must submit a completed visa application form, which can be obtained online or at the Turkish embassy or consulate. A recent passport-sized photograph is also required, along with proof of travel arrangements such as flight tickets and hotel reservations. Applicants must also provide evidence of financial means to support their stay in Turkey, such as bank statements or proof of employment. Finally, applicants must provide a visa fee payment receipt. It is important to ensure that all documents are accurate and up-to-date to increase the chances of a successful visa application.
